Overview
- Shikhar Dhawan’s book The One: Cricket, My Life and More was released June 26, 2025, through HarperCollins India and promises an unfiltered look at his personal and professional journey.
- He reveals a secret 2006 India A tour relationship in Australia, recounting how smuggling his girlfriend into the room he shared with Rohit Sharma distracted him and dented his form.
- Dhawan traces his transition from wicketkeeper to opening batsman, highlighting his records across 34 Tests, 167 ODIs and 68 T20 Internationals before retiring in 2024.
- The memoir shares behind-the-scenes dressing-room anecdotes, including his first impressions of Mahendra Singh Dhoni and playful banter with teammates like Rohit Sharma.
- Dhawan contrasts the less invasive media scrutiny of his early career with today’s social-media pressures, reflecting on how public narratives in cricket have evolved.
